Unbeaten British junior welterweight Jack Rafferty will try to continue his impressive run against domestic rival Mark Chamberlain on Saturday night in Manchester.
MANCHESTER, England – Jack Rafferty and Mark Chamberlain both comfortably made the 140-pound limit Friday ahead of their 12-round junior welterweight title fight.
Shaw’s Rafferty (26-0, 17 KOs) has scored three consecutive stoppage victories since being signed by Queensberry Promotions last year and is intent on making a big impression in his first headline appearance. He tipped the scales at 139.5 pounds.
Chamberlain (17-1, 12 KOs) also weighed in at 139.5. The 26-year-old southpaw from Portsmouth will be keen to rediscover the exciting form that earned him the opportunity to perform on a number of Riyadh Season cards.
In the evening’s co-feature, Zak Miller (16-1, 3 KOs) will defend his Commonwealth featherweight title over 12 rounds against Leicester’s Leon Woodstock (16-4, 7 KOs).
A loud group of Miller fans made the short journey from Ashton to see their man step on the scale at 125.4 pounds. The intense Woodstock weighed 125.1.
